Applications available for Ocoee neighborhood grants

Applicants have until March 20 to submit their requests.

The city of Ocoee has opened its application period for the Ocoee Neighborhood Matching Grant Program. The grant program is open to homeowners’ associations and to neighborhoods without a structured HOA. 

The goal of the program is to assist residents with making improvements to their neighborhoods. A total of $12,000 is available, and the maximum grant award is $2,000. 

The deadline to submit applications is March 20. Applications are available online at ocoee.org and at the City Hall reception desk. Completed applications should be mailed or delivered to Ocoee City Hall, 150 North Lakeshore Drive.
